Description
Discover an exceptional commercial opportunity in the heart of 29 Palms with this 1.19-acre property consisting of two parcels, ideally situated just blocks from The Reset Hotel, one of the desert's most thoughtfully designed and highly acclaimed hospitality destinations. Zoned Service Commercial (CS), this property offers outstanding development potential in an area designated for a broad range of commercial and light industrial uses. According to the City of 29 Palms Municipal Code, the CS district is intended to accommodate more intensive commercial operations, including wholesaling, auto and truck repair and service, lumberyards, machine shops, light manufacturing, and recycling facilities. High-quality design standards are encouraged to enhance the area's visual appeal while supporting business growth. Electricity is available at the street, helping streamline the development process and reducing upfront infrastructure costs. This rare commercial offering presents a blank canvas adjacent to a design-forward destination that continues to attract visitors and investment to the area. With excellent visibility, strong development potential, and proximity to increasing tourist traffic, this property is strategically located approximately five miles from the north entrance of Joshua Tree National Park. Its prime location provides access to one of California's most sought-after outdoor recreation markets, making it an ideal opportunity for investors, developers, and business owners seeking a foothold in the rapidly growing High Desert region.
